Sleeping Bouncer vulnerabilità hardware critiche pre-boot
La vulnerabilità Sleeping Bouncer rappresenta una delle minacce più insidiose scoperte negli ultimi anni nel panorama della sicurezza informatica. Questa falla critica colpisce le protezioni pre-boot di alcune delle schede madri più utilizzate al mondo, incluse quelle prodotte da Gigabyte, MSI, ASRock e ASUS. La particolarità di questa vulnerabilità risiede nella sua capacità di agire prima che i normali sistemi di sicurezza del computer si attivino, creando una finestra di opportunità per gli attaccanti.
Cos’è la vulnerabilità Sleeping Bouncer
Sleeping Bouncer è una vulnerabilità zero-day che sfrutta una debolezza critica nell’implementazione hardware delle protezioni pre-boot. Il nome stesso suggerisce la natura insidiosa di questa falla: come un buttafuori addormentato, i meccanismi di sicurezza che dovrebbero proteggere il sistema sono presenti ma non funzionano correttamente.
La vulnerabilità si manifesta attraverso un difetto nell’implementazione della funzione IOMMU (Input-Output Memory Management Unit) e della protezione DMA pre-boot. Questo significa che anche quando le impostazioni del BIOS mostrano che le protezioni sono attive, l’hardware non riesce ad attivare correttamente questi meccanismi di sicurezza.
Ciò che rende particolarmente pericolosa questa vulnerabilità è il fatto che opera a un livello così basso del sistema che può bypassare completamente:
- Password BIOS/UEFI
- Protezioni DMA
- Secure Boot
- Sistemi di autenticazione tradizionali
Come funziona l’attacco Sleeping Bouncer
Il meccanismo di attacco di Sleeping Bouncer è sofisticato quanto preoccupante. Gli attaccanti sfruttano la finestra temporale creata dal malfunzionamento delle protezioni hardware per iniettare codice malevolo direttamente nella sequenza di avvio del computer.
Durante questa fase critica, il malware può:
- Assumere controllo del sistema con privilegi elevati prima che il sistema operativo si carichi
- Installare rootkit persistenti che sopravvivono ai riavvii e alle reinstallazioni del sistema operativo
- Modificare il firmware per mantenere l’accesso anche dopo le patch di sicurezza
- Intercettare e modificare tutti i dati che passano attraverso il sistema
La particolarità di questo attacco è che avviene completamente sotto il radar dei tradizionali sistemi di rilevamento malware, poiché opera a un livello inferiore rispetto al sistema operativo stesso.
Produttori colpiti e modelli vulnerabili
I principali produttori di schede madri colpiti da questa vulnerabilità includono alcuni dei marchi più rispettati nel settore:
- Gigabyte – Diverse serie di schede madri per gaming e workstation
- MSI – Modelli di fascia alta e gaming
- ASRock – Schede madri consumer e professional
- ASUS – Linee ROG e TUF principalmente
È importante notare che la vulnerabilità non è limitata a modelli specifici ma riguarda un difetto nell’implementazione hardware che può essere presente in diverse generazioni di prodotti.
L’impatto nel mondo del gaming competitivo
Una delle scoperte più interessanti riguardo a Sleeping Bouncer è che è stata identificata dai ricercatori di sicurezza di Riot Games durante controlli di routine sui sistemi di gaming. Questa scoperta ha avuto implicazioni immediate per il gaming competitivo.
Riot Games, attraverso il suo sistema anti-cheat Vanguard, ha preso misure drastiche per proteggere l’integrità dei suoi giochi competitivi:
- Controlli pre-gioco più severi per verificare l’integrità del firmware
- Blocco dell’accesso ai giochi competitivi per sistemi non aggiornati
- Scansioni più approfondite delle protezioni a livello hardware
- Monitoraggio continuo delle anomalie nei processi di avvio
Questa risposta sottolinea quanto sia critica la vulnerabilità: se un’azienda di gaming è disposta a bloccare potenzialmente migliaia di giocatori per proteggere l’integrità del gioco, significa che il rischio è estremamente elevato.
Cheating a livello hardware
La vulnerabilità Sleeping Bouncer apre la strada a una nuova generazione di cheat che operano a livello firmware. Questi cheat sono particolarmente pericolosi perché:
- Non possono essere rilevati dai tradizionali sistemi anti-cheat
- Persistono anche dopo formattazioni complete del sistema
- Possono modificare i dati del gioco prima che raggiungano il sistema operativo
- Sono estremamente difficili da rimuovere una volta installati
Patch e aggiornamenti disponibili
I produttori di schede madri hanno reagito rapidamente alla scoperta della vulnerabilità, rilasciando aggiornamenti critici del BIOS/UEFI. Questi aggiornamenti includono:
Gigabyte
Ha rilasciato patch per le sue serie più popolari, concentrandosi inizialmente sui modelli gaming di fascia alta. Gli aggiornamenti correggono l’implementazione IOMMU difettosa e migliorano i controlli di integrità pre-boot.
MSI
Ha pubblicato aggiornamenti per le sue linee Gaming e Creator, con particolare attenzione ai modelli utilizzati negli eSport. Le patch includono anche miglioramenti al Secure Boot.
ASRock
Ha fornito aggiornamenti per le serie Phantom Gaming e Taichi, implementando controlli aggiuntivi sulla catena di avvio e verifiche dell’integrità del firmware.
ASUS
Ha aggiornato le sue popolari linee ROG e TUF, introducendo nuovi meccanismi di protezione DMA e migliorando l’implementazione delle protezioni pre-boot.
Microsoft ha parallelamente aggiornato il boot manager di Windows per revocare le versioni vulnerabili del firmware e introdurre controlli aggiuntivi durante la fase di avvio del sistema operativo.
Come proteggersi dalla vulnerabilità Sleeping Bouncer
La protezione contro Sleeping Bouncer richiede un approccio multilivello che combina aggiornamenti hardware e software con buone pratiche di sicurezza.
Aggiornamenti immediati
La prima e più importante azione da intraprendere è l’aggiornamento del firmware:
- Identificare il modello esatto della propria scheda madre
- Visitare il sito ufficiale del produttore per scaricare l’ultima versione del BIOS
- Seguire attentamente le istruzioni di installazione fornite dal produttore
- Verificare che l’aggiornamento sia stato applicato correttamente
Misure di sicurezza aggiuntive
Oltre agli aggiornamenti del firmware, è consigliabile implementare ulteriori misure di protezione:
- Limitare l’accesso fisico ai computer, specialmente in ambienti condivisi
- Monitorare i tempi di avvio per individuare anomalie
- Utilizzare strumenti di verifica dell’integrità del firmware quando disponibili
- Mantenere aggiornato il sistema operativo e tutti i driver
- Implementare controlli di sicurezza aggiuntivi per ambienti critici
Ambiente gaming e professionale
Per chi utilizza il computer per gaming competitivo o lavoro sensibile, è particolarmente importante:
- Verificare regolarmente lo stato delle patch di sicurezza
- Utilizzare solo hardware da fonti affidabili
- Implementare sistemi di backup robusti
- Considerare l’utilizzo di hardware dedicato per attività critiche
La vulnerabilità Sleeping Bouncer rappresenta un promemoria importante di quanto sia critica la sicurezza a livello hardware. Mentre i produttori continuano a rilasciare patch e miglioramenti, è fondamentale che gli utenti mantengano i loro sistemi aggiornati e adottino pratiche di sicurezza appropriate. Solo attraverso un approccio proattivo e consapevole possiamo proteggerci efficacemente da queste sofisticate minacce che operano ai livelli più profondi dei nostri sistemi informatici.